Specialists who want becoming prosthetics and orthotics technicians should complete a Masters program in this area. Applicants usually originate from a range of undergraduate majors, including biology, chemistry, physics, and also psychology. Prerequisites differ by program, yet might include a lab-based program in human anatomy and also physiology. Once they have finished the masters program, candidates have to finish an one-year residency. Some universities use full time training courses in prosthetics and orthotics, which take about three to four years. Trainees must sign up with the Health and Treatment Professions Council (HCPC) to become a prosthetics and also orthotics technician. Alternatively, they can choose an instruction training course to discover the profession. The United State Department of Education and learning lists training in O&P as a national top priority. Raising obesity and diabetic issues and the aging Baby Boomer generation add to an absence of orthotists. The supply of qualified professionals is critical to meeting the growing demand for these solutions. If there is a shortage of orthotists, this will certainly have significant unfavorable effects on the quality of health care and the lives of those receiving such assistance.
